Packaging Box Design to Ensure Transportation Safety and Brand Image


With high-quality sprayer products in place, how to transport them safely and securely to the Nepalese clients was also a key consideration for us. Therefore, we also put a lot of effort into the design of the packaging boxes for these 2,000 sprayers.


Our design team took multiple aspects into account and comprehensively considered various possible factors during transportation. Firstly, the packaging boxes are made of high-strength and environmentally friendly materials, which can ensure that they are sturdy enough during long-distance transportation and loading and unloading processes, effectively resisting collisions, squeezes, and other situations to protect the sprayers from damage. At the same time, it also meets the current requirements for environmental protection, demonstrating our emphasis on sustainable development.


In terms of structural design, each sprayer is firmly fixed in its dedicated slot to avoid mutual friction and collision. Meanwhile, reasonable space is reserved to facilitate necessary ventilation during transportation and prevent problems such as moisture caused by long-term sealing. Moreover, the appearance of the packaging boxes has been carefully designed, incorporating the iconic elements of our brand as well as elements of Nepalese local cultural characteristics. This not only highlights the brand image but also makes the Nepalese clients feel our respect and dedication to their market, enabling them to be easily recognized among numerous goods and be unique.
